_      _     _        
 _ __  _ __ ___ (_) ___| | __| |_  ___ 
| '_ \| '__/ _ \| |/ _ | |/ _   _|/ _ \
| |_) | | | (_) | |  __|   < | |_|  __|
| .__/|_|  \___// |\___/_|\_\\___|\___/
|_|            |_/                     

IoT Smart Home Automation

Zeitraum: 2021    Team-Größe: 5
Rahmen: Beruflich   Tätigkeiten: Berater, Ingenieur, Manager
Kurzbeschreibung:   Neue Erfahrungen:
Ziel des Projekts ist die Entwicklung und der Betrieb eines Backendsystems für eine intelligente Verknüpfung und Verwaltung von IoT-Geräten. Man kann diese Geräte in zwei Kategorien unterscheiden:
  • Physikalische Geräte wie z. B. Haushaltsgeräte (Ofen, Lampen, Staubsaugerroboter,...)
  • Virtuelle Geräte wie z. B. Tesla API, Mercedes Me API, Bahn API,...
Das Backendsystem hat eine Microservicearchitektur, die unter Azure Kubernetes Service (AKS) ausgeführt wird. Continuous Integration (CI) und Continuous Delivery (CD) werden in Azure-DevOps abgebildet.
 
  • API-First mit mehreren Microservice-Entwicklungsteams
  • CI/CD von kompletter Microservice-Landschaft
  • Reaktive Entwicklung mit Spring Boot und Reactor
  • Entwicklung mit Azure DevOps
  • Entwicklung für Azure Cloud
Eingesetzte Technologien:  

HomeConnect Plus